About the Role
The Agile Coach will coach, mentor, and guide product teams, leaders, and stakeholders through Agile adoption and transformation initiatives across MTA-IT. This role advances large-scale Agile Transformation efforts by promoting Agile principles, fostering cross-functional collaboration, and driving continuous improvement. The Agile Coach partners with teams to enhance delivery practices, align outcomes with business objectives, and improve operational excellence.
Responsibilities
- Coaching teams on Agile frameworks such as Scrum and Kanban
- Facilitating training sessions and workshops
- Implementing best practices and tools
- Leveraging metrics to inform decision-making and improve performance
Requirements
- Demonstrated experience enabling and supporting Agile and/or enterprise transformation efforts in large, complex environments
- Operates in a consultative capacity without direct managerial responsibilities, focusing on influencing teams, enabling cultural change, and supporting enterprise-wide Agile maturity in alignment with the broader MTA-IT strategy.
